Elevate Your Mind with Rebecca Wiener McGregor is a podcast for women whose life looks good on paper but doesn't always feel that way inside. Hosted by subconscious expert, transformational hypnotist, and author Rebecca Wiener McGregor, each episode explores the hidden patterns that shape how we think, feel, work, love, lead, and experience our lives. Many of the women Rebecca works with have built beautiful lives. They are successful, capable, responsible, and deeply caring. They are often the women everyone depends on. Yet beneath the surface, they find themselves exhausted, overthinking, carrying too much responsibility, struggling to relax, or wondering why life doesn't feel as good as it looks. Through honest conversations, powerful insights, real client stories, practical tools, and more than two decades of experience helping women create lasting transformation, Rebecca helps listeners understand what is really driving their patterns and how to create change at the root. Topics include: • Subconscious transformation • Overthinking and emotional overwhelm • Self-worth and self-trust • Relationships and boundaries • Success, pressure, and responsibility • Nervous system regulation • Hypnosis and personal transformation • Finding more joy, peace, presence, and freedom • Creating a life that feels as good on the inside as it looks on the outside Whether you're a leader, entrepreneur, healer, helper, caregiver, or simply a woman who is ready to stop spending her days trying to calm herself down, this podcast will help you understand yourself more deeply and create meaningful change from the inside out.     Your Subconscious Is Shaping Your Reality in the Background

    Why can two people with the same qualifications, experience, and opportunity have completely different outcomes? In this episode of Elevate Your Mind, Master Hypnotist, Subconscious Expert, and Leadership Coach Rebecca Wiener McGregor explores how the subconscious mind shapes your reality long before an important moment begins. You'll discover why confidence isn't always about personality, how your subconscious rehearses future experiences, and why old interpretations can quietly influence your relationships, career, leadership, and everyday life. In this episode you'll learn: • How your subconscious predicts and interprets everyday experiences • Why two people can experience the same event completely differently • The hidden connection between safety, confidence, and performance • Why your nervous system influences how others experience you • The difference between an event and the meaning you attach to it • How curiosity can begin changing long-standing subconscious patterns If you've ever wondered why you overthink, lose confidence in important moments, or struggle to enjoy opportunities you've worked hard to create, this conversation will give you a completely new way of understanding yourself.     Why Burnout Doesn't Go Away on Vacation

    The Hidden Reason You Can't Relax   Why does it take days before you finally relax on vacation? Why do you come home feeling like you need another vacation?     Why Do We Pull Back When Things Start Going Well?

    The subconscious reason you keep slowing down right before your breakthrough. Have you ever noticed that just as life starts getting really good...you slow down? You procrastinate. You overthink. You lose momentum. You suddenly question everything—even though this is exactly what you've been working toward. If you've ever wondered, "Why do I keep getting in my own way?" this episode is for you.   In today's conversation, Rebecca shares why this pattern isn't about laziness, discipline, or a lack of confidence. It's about the subconscious mind doing exactly what it was designed to do—keeping you safe.   You'll learn: • Why your subconscious values familiarity over possibility • Why you pull back when opportunities begin showing up • Why "knowledge feels productive, but movement feels vulnerable" • How to teach your subconscious that more success, more abundance, more visibility, and more joy are safe to receive   One simple shift that can help you stop waiting and start moving again If you're a woman who knows you're capable of more—but keeps finding yourself slowing down just before your breakthrough—I think this episode will help you understand yourself in a completely new way.   If someone came to mind while you were listening, would you share this episode with her?
